Boise is rallying for a massive community meal-packing event on the National Day of Service and Remembrance, aiming to pack 130,000 meals with just 40 more volunteers needed—turning remembrance into real impact for local families facing food insecurity. The event, hosted at JUMP Boise from 9 AM to 11 AM, marks the city’s first large-scale participation in this nationwide initiative, coordinated by 9/11 Day across 51 locations. Volunteers will help distribute meals directly to The Idaho Foodbank, contributing to a national effort expected to pack over 18 million meals.
